Strawberry Lasagna

This is a great dessert to serve at a dinner party. It makes approximately 4-5 individual servings.

Do not use Cool Whip for this recipe. It is important that you use real whipped cream! Ricotta cheese is available in a low-fat version, but it does not have the same taste as regular ricotta cheese. Enjoy a real dessert and don't fret about the calories!

Moderately Easy
Combine strawberries with 2 tablespoons of sugar, orange juice and orange zest in a medium sized bowl.

In a second bowl, blend together ricotta cheese, whipped cream and 1 tablespoon of sugar.

Slice pound cake into slices, about 1" thick and place each slice on a separate plate.

Layer as if you are making a regular lasagne: ricotta mixture, strawberries, ricotta, slice of pound cake.

Make two more layers the same way.

Place final piece of cake on top and add some strawberries to top it off.
